Sophisticated Diagnostic Equipment
Even though symptoms can seem similar between systems, our ASE-qualified team rapidly determine underlying issues using state-of-the-art diagnostic equipment. We start with analyzing OBD systems to capture freeze-frame data, mode $06$ results, and pending codes, before confirming with bi-directional controls to activate actuators and confirm response. You'll notice us correlate live data PIDs-fuel trims, misfire counters, sensor voltages-against factory specifications to isolate actual faults, not simply clearing codes.
Following this, we use high-resolution lab equipment to scope circuits, analyzing signal patterns for electrical variations, fuel injection timing, and network communication. We use thermal imaging to reveal power leaks, faulty connections, and irregular component temperatures without taking things apart. As needed, we carry out smoke testing to detect EVAP and induction leaks. The outcome: precise root-cause identification and a repair plan you can trust with complete assurance.

Proactive Maintenance Solutions
Regular preventive service maintains your vehicle within specifications and minimizes unplanned maintenance. We create a detailed service plan based on manufacturer recommendations, driving conditions, and common failure points. With each scheduled service, we perform thorough evaluations, verify fluid status, and measure serviceable parts against established standards. We measure and log critical measurements including battery performance, brake parameters, tire wear, alignment angles, and belt and hose condition.
We provide fluid flushing when chemical analysis indicates the need - addressing power steering fluid particulates. Professional oil analysis is done as required to validate drain intervals. Critical parts including wipers, cabin air filters, and PCV systems are changed based on manufacturer guidelines, not estimates. Periodic torque checks and software updates round out your maintenance profile, helping minimize maintenance costs and system downtime.
